Official EPSG transformation from Ocotepeque 1935 to CR05

The EPSG Geodetic Parameter Dataset defines 1 transformation between Ocotepeque 1935 (EPSG:5451) and CR05 (EPSG:5365). Its parameters, accuracy and area of use are listed below.

Ocotepeque 1935 to CR05 (1)

EPSG:6890±8 m
Method:
Geocentric translations (geog2D domain)
Area of use:
Costa Rica - onshore
Scope:
Topographic mapping.
ParameterValueUnit
X-axis translation(tx)213.11metre
Y-axis translation(ty)9.37metre
Z-axis translation(tz)-74.95metre

May be taken as approximate transformation Ocotepeque to WGS 84 - see code 5470.

How accurate is converting Ocotepeque 1935 to CR05?
The most accurate official EPSG transformation between these systems is accurate to about ±8 m within its stated area of use. Browser-based converters approximate datum shifts with Helmert parameters; for surveying-grade work apply the official transformation in a desktop GIS.
